York Museums Trust is delighted to announce that the Yorkshire Museum will re-open on Friday 8th April with an exciting new exhibition; The Ryedale Hoard: A Roman Mystery.
The Ryedale Hoard contains some of Yorkshire’s most significant Roman objects including an 1,800 year old bust of the Roman Emperor Marcus Aurelius . For the …

York Museums Trust are delighted to be partnering with House of Memories, an award-winning dementia awareness programme developed by National Museums Liverpool, to launch a new and free digital app that will help people living with dementia.
The newly created package, entitled ‘York Memories’, will help people recall memories using a variety of …
